Synesthesia
Synesthesia Facebook page
A young, creative, synth/electronic duo from Hesketh Bank. Expect a cloud of electronic contemporary music with quirky props, dancey beats and future trancey sounds and keys. Influences are Rockysopp, Jean Michelle Jarre, Lindstorm and Lemon Jelly.
Pose for the Camera

A young indie/rock band from Skelmersdale we met during a live set on Dune FM. Expect originals and covers with soothing bluesy female vocals with pop/grunge guitar riffs, influences are Kings of Leon, Speedway and Mc Fly.

Jackpot Golden Boys

A highly creative four piece band from Hesketh Bank. Our most high energy, high octane, sugar fuelled band we have lined up. How can a band be exciting, spooky, fun, nostalgic, phenomenal and melodic all at the same time??! You will expect heavy rocking guitar riffs, sweeping keyboard melodies, hard hitting drum action with catchy dancey beats.
Tim Lee
Tim Lee MySpace
A singer/song writer from Crewe who has been with us from the birth of our festival. Expect a mellow acoustic sound with honest, observational heart felt lyrics on life. Influences are Paul Simon, David Bowie and Bjork.
Vision Thing

A talented and creative 5 piece indie/folk/rock band from Southport .
Expect creative original lyrics, an ambient atmosphere, melodic, harmonious, chilled out guitar, trumpet, violin, keys and vocals, perfect music for a warm summer afternoon sitting with friends, a breath of fresh air, influences are diverse ranging from Manic Street Preachers, Nirvana, Kings of Leon to Garfunkel, The Beatles and Elvis to Pink Floyde, Gong and Goldfrapp
The Synergy

A young vibrant five piece alternative rock band from Tarleton. Expect to hear originals and covers with classic rockin guitar, catchy beats, rappin vocals with a retro 90's feel, influences are Blink 182, Foo Fighters, 30 Seconds To Mars, AC/DC, Greenday and Rage Against The Machine.
Jump In The Woods

A 3 piece feel good pop/rock cover band from Skelmersdale joined together in a love of music, guaranteed to get you foot tapping, singing along and dancing to your favourite tunes. Expect to hear music music ranging anything from rock to motown, covers include The Beatles, Rolling Stones, Santana,The Zutons to name but a few.
Scurvy Dogg

A rebellious 6 piece punk/acoustic/folk band from Skelmersdale. Expect a broad set of classic old punk anthems and folk songs with some humour thrown in for good measure, influences from The Clash, The Pogues, The Levellers, Sex Pistols and The Stranglers.

Resuss

A Wirral based band who are a team of paramedics by day and rock/pop stars by night, have been with us from the birth of our festival and are real audience pleasers. Expect revved up guitars, poppy punky melodies and grungy riffs with a Kings of Leon, Foo Fighters and Greenday influence
Loveless
sLoveless on MySpace
A young band based in Tarleton consisting of 3 rock stars from 1983 with BIG hair, tight ripped clothes, shades, tattoos and a tonne of makeup, the coolest!! This band just screams rock'n'roll! Expect to hear screaming guitar, hard hitting drums with 80's classic rock vocals. Their influences are Bon Jovi, Prince, Motley Crue, Poison and Alice Cooper.
Innuendo

A hot new 5 piece ‘feel good' rock band from Tarleton. Expect raw rock talent, a hard core metal and classic rock hybrid, expect allot of head banging, emotion and movement. Influences are Black label Society, Metallica, Iron Maiden, Led Zep and Guns'n'Roses.
Northerndaze

A 4 piece indie/folk band from Liverpool who are one of our favourites from the Woodland Stage. Expect foot tapping female folksy vocals with original lyrics and harmonica, drums and rhythm guitar strings, influences are Bob Dylan, The Kinks, The Clash, John Lennon, The Pogues and Janis Joplin.
Naomi Gidney

A young female vocalist from Hesketh Bank, sings most weeks for our local church. Expect blues, emotion, drama, pop, soul with a late 50's-60's vibe and style. Influences are Narnia, Prince Caspian and musicals like Wicked.
Red men Don't Walk

A 4 piece original indie/rock/pop/country band from Ormskirk. Expect to hear country rap with guitars with a rock'n'roll groove. They ROCKED last years festival with their base lovin, guitar plumbin drum ticklin action, influences are The Racnteurs,Wilson Pickett, Marvin Gaye, Jonny Cash and The Beatles. Rock'n'roll dancing and singing along guaranteed!
